- Ride the Niagara Skywheel
When it comes to romantic activities, a nighttime ride on a Ferris wheel is a time-tested staple. That being the case, no Niagara-bound couple can go home without taking a moonlit spin on the world-famous Niagara Skywheel. Located in the middle of Clifton Hill, the Niagara Skywheel stands at a whopping 175 feet and offers visitors a truly spectacular view of the iconic falls. For maximum convenience, each of the Skywheel’s spacious gondolas is equipped with heating and air conditioning, ensuring that riders are perfectly comfortable no matter what time of year they’re visiting. While the Skywheel is operational during both daytime and nighttime hours, couples are likely to appreciate the romantic ambiance and one-of-a-kind scenery synonymous with after-dark rides.
- Take in the Botanical Gardens
Couples who enjoy long walks and gorgeous scenery will feel right at home when visiting the Niagara Parks Botanical Gardens. Boasting 99 acres of picturesque plant life, the Botanical Gardens are home to an expansive array of flowers, vegetable plantings and herbs. In addition, couples looking for a great romantic mood setter will want to visit the world-renowned rose garden, which houses over 2,400 roses.Visitors who aren’t fond of walking will be pleased to learn that the park offers horse-drawn carriage tours. Additionally, cost-conscious guests should be aware that admission is free all year long, with parking being a very reasonable $5.
